OVERVIEW
Millcraft Furniture, a traditional Amish woodshop, faced a costly bottleneck: manual sanding variations. Inconsistent hand-sanding across multiple employees led to uneven stain absorption and a frustrating “double-pay penalty” for rework¹. To protect their lifetime warranty and “hand-built” philosophy, Millcraft bypassed standard mass-production machinery and integrated the Omni Robotic System. Despite having zero computerized machinery experience, the team achieved full production in under a week. The integration eliminated human sanding variations and reallocated over $117,000/yearly in burdened labor¹ to profitable assembly, securing a rapid three-year ROI while drastically improving shop morale and air quality.

THE PROBLEM
The "Hidden Tax" of Manual Sanding
At Millcraft Furniture, the goal is a consistent, premium finish on every piece of high-end hardwood furniture. However, relying on five or six different people to sand by hand introduced natural variation. Even skilled artisans produce inconsistencies that only become evident after the stain is applied. These slight variations in sanding depth cause uneven absorption, resulting in mismatched shades across a single bedroom set.
For a 20-person shop like Millcraft, manual sanding variability is a silent profit killer. When a walnut or cherry piece is sanded incorrectly, the material is rarely lost, but it triggers rework that pulls skilled labor back into sanding, staining, and inspection. This is the Double-Pay Penalty: you pay once to make it, then again to fix it. Over time, these interruptions disrupt flow and quietly reduce production capacity.
Industry data shows that if only one bedroom set per week requires rework, the hidden cost of double-paid labor can exceed $20,000 annually.¹

¹
Note on calculations: Financial impacts are modeled estimates rather than the shop’s direct accounting records. We calculated rework costs based on the wasted production time spent fixing mistakes (extra sanding, re-staining, and handling). This approach is backed by manufacturing research on lost production capacity (INFORMS) and custom woodworking financial benchmarks for fully loaded hourly shop rates (Woodworking Network / FDMC). Labor costs utilize official Ohio woodworking wage data, while material waste is treated as a secondary factor.
